tresult PLUGIN_API Vst3PluginProxyImpl::connect(IConnectionPoint* other) {
// When the host is trying to connect two plugin proxy objects, we can just
// identify the other object by its instance IDs and then connect the
// objects in the Wine plugin host directly
if (auto other_proxy = dynamic_cast<Vst3PluginProxy*>(other)) {
return bridge.send_message(YaConnectionPoint::Connect{
.instance_id = instance_id(),
.other_instance_id = other_proxy->instance_id()});
} else {
// TODO: Add support for `ConnectionProxy` and similar objects
bridge.logger.log(
"WARNING: The host passed a proxy proxy object to "
"'IConnectionPoint::connect()'. This is currently not supported.");
return Steinberg::kNotImplemented;
}
}
tresult PLUGIN_API Vst3PluginProxyImpl::disconnect(IConnectionPoint* other) {
// See `Vst3PluginProxyImpl::connect()`
if (auto other_proxy = dynamic_cast<Vst3PluginProxy*>(other)) {
return bridge.send_message(YaConnectionPoint::Disconnect{
.instance_id = instance_id(),
.other_instance_id = other_proxy->instance_id()});
} else {
// TODO: Add support for `ConnectionProxy` and similar objects
bridge.logger.log(
"WARNING: The host passed a proxy proxy object to "
"'IConnectionPoint::disconnect()'. This is currently not "
"supported.");
return Steinberg::kNotImplemented;
}
}
tresult PLUGIN_API
Vst3PluginProxyImpl::notify(Steinberg::Vst::IMessage* message) {
// Since there is no way to enumerate over all values in an
// `IAttributeList`, we can only support relaying messages that were sent by
// our own objects. This is only needed to support hosts that place a
// connection proxy between two objects instead of connecting them directly.
// If the objects are connected directly we also connected them directly on
// the Wine side, so we don't have to do any additional when those objects
// pass through messages.
if (auto message_impl = dynamic_cast<YaMessage*>(message)) {
return bridge.send_message(YaConnectionPoint::Notify{
.instance_id = instance_id(), .message = *message_impl});
} else {
bridge.logger.log(
"WARNING: Unknown message type passed to "
"'IConnectionPoint::notify()', ignoring");
return Steinberg::kNotImplemented;
}
}
